Our Mission

In an era where global interconnectivity has reshaped the way we perceive and interact with the world, understanding the unique struggles and aspirations of every community becomes imperative. The Palestinian narrative, rich with history, culture, and resilience, has often been overshadowed or misunderstood in broader conversations. It’s against this backdrop that the “PALPAC” think tank was born.

Our mission is straightforward yet profound: To amplify the understanding and support for Palestinian rights, both within society and on a global stage. We believe that through comprehensive research, open dialogue, and dedicated advocacy, we can elevate Palestinian voices and pave the way towards a just, democratic, and peaceful future. Our core values of justice, research, and dialogue form the pillars of our approach. We are committed to producing impartial and thorough research, fostering an environment of mutual respect and understanding, and championing the cause of justice for Palestinians irrespective of their location. Whether you’re a Palestinian looking for a platform to share your story, a scholar aiming to contribute through research, a policymaker seeking insights, or simply someone wanting to learn and support, “PALPAC” welcomes you. Together, we hope to make a significant stride towards a world that acknowledges, respects, and supports the democratic rights of the Palestinian people.

Core Values

1. Justice: Palestinians deserve equal rights, irrespective of where they reside.
2. Research: Public opinion shaping based on thorough and impartial research.
3. Dialogue: Communication and collaboration are keys to mutual understanding and peace.

Main Agenda

1. Research: Conduct studies that shed light on the conditions and rights of Palestinians, both within society and in the Middle East.
2. Education: Offer educational initiatives that enhance the understanding of Palestinian culture, history, and present circumstances.
3. Networking: Construct a platform where Palestinians, scholars, policymakers, and the general public can converge and collaborate.
4. Advocacy: Engage with decision-makers within society to champion Palestinian rights and justice.
5. Media and Communication: Utilize media to emphasize Palestinian voices and disseminate knowledge about Palestinian rights.

PALPAC Organization

Registered under Swedish law as a subsidiary of PBN BUSINESS NETWORK E.K FÖR
